Bmw X5 problems

The BMW X5 is a mid-size luxury crossover SUV produced by BMW. The X5 made its debut in 1999 as the E53 model. It was BMW's first SUV. At launch, it featured all-wheel drive and was available with either a manual or automatic gearbox. The second generation was launched in 2006, and was known internally as the E70. The E70 featured the torque-split capable xDrive all-wheel drive system mated to an automatic gearbox. In 2009, the X5 M performance variant was released as a 2010 model.
BMW marketed the X5 officially as a "Sports Activity Vehicle" (SAV), rather than an SUV, to indicate its on-road handling capability despite its large dimensions. The X5 signaled a shift away from the utilisation of body-on-frame construction, in favour of more modern monocoque chassis construction. Although the Mercedes-Benz M-Class was introduced more than a year prior to the X5, the X5 was the first to utilise a monocoque chassis. The M-Class used body-on-frame construction until its second generation.
The X5 is primarily manufactured in North America, at BMW Group Plant Spartanburg. Assembly operations also take place in Russia by Avtotor, along with operations in India, Indonesia, Malaysia, and Thailand. The X5 is also modified for armoured security versions, at the BMW de México Toluca plant.
The automaker's SAV series, which was started by the X5, has expanded with derivations of other number-series BMWs. This began in 2003 with the X3, and continued in 2008 with the X6 (which shares its platform with the X5).

Common Bmw X5 problems
Based on the information from the sources provided, here are some common problems with the BMW X5 as reported by owners:
- Oil Leaks:
-
- Problem: Common concerns include motor oil leaks due to gasket failures or issues with the oil filter housing and valve cover gaskets.
- Solution: Addressing oil leaks by inspecting and replacing gaskets and seals as needed, along with regular oil changes using high-quality oil.
-
- Air Suspension Problems:
-
- Problem: Issues related to the air suspension system have been reported.
- Solution: Seeking professional inspection and repair for air suspension problems to ensure proper functioning of this component.
-
- Transmission and X Drive Issues:
-
- Problem: Neglecting service for the xDrive All-Wheel Drive system and transmission fluid changes can lead to transmission problems.
- Solution: Regular fluid changes for the transmission and xDrive system are recommended to prevent issues and maintain the longevity of these components.
-
- Front Control Arm Bushings Wear:
-
- Problem: Owners have experienced a clunking noise from the front of the car and steering wheel wandering, indicating quick wear of front control arm bushings.
- Solution: Replacing the control arm bushings or arms to address this issue, which can be a relatively simple repair.
-
- Driveshaft Spline Failure:
-
- Problem: A metallic grinding noise from the front wheels can indicate driveshaft spline failure, especially in X5s that have been driven hard.
- Solution: Replacing the driveshaft or repairing the stripped-out portion with longer splines to resolve this issue.
-
- Engine Timing Chain Issues:
-
- Problem: Guide rails on the E53 X5s can deteriorate quickly, leading to timing chain skipping.
- Solution: Replacing the guide rails and potentially the timing chain to address the engine dropping out of phase issue.
-
- Brake System Wear:
-
- Problem: The BMW X5 is known for being tough on brake parts, leading to decreased brake effectiveness over time.
- Solution: Regularly checking and replacing brake components like callipers, brake pads, and discs to maintain brake performance.
-
These common problems highlight the importance of regular maintenance and prompt attention to issues to ensure the BMW X5's optimal performance and longevity.

Are BMW X5 expensive to maintain?
A BMW X5 will cost about $18,389 for maintenance and repairs during its first 10 years of service. This is more than the industry average for luxury SUV models by $2,675. There is also a 54.61% chance that a X5 will require a major repair during that time. This is 15.05% worse than similar vehicles in this segment.

- Summary: BMW of North America, LLC. (BMW) is recalling certain 2023-2024 X1, X5, X6, X7, XM, 530i, i5, 740i, 760i, i7, and 750e vehicles. Please see the recall report for a complete list of models and model years. The integrated brake (IB) system may malfunction and result in a loss of power brake assist or cause the Antilock Brake (ABS) and Dynamic Stability Control (DSC) systems to not function properly.
- Consequence: A loss of power brake assist can extend the distance required to stop the vehicle. Additionally, malfunctioning ABS and/or DSC systems can cause a loss of vehicle control. Either of these scenarios can increase the risk of a crash.
- Remedy: Dealers will replace the integrated brake module, free of charge. Interim owner notification letters notifying owners of the safety risk are expected to be mailed November 22, 2024. Second letters will be mailed once the parts are available. Owners may contact BMW customer service at 1-800-525-7417. Vehicles in this recall were previously repaired under recall number 24V-104 and will need to have the new remedy completed.

- Summary: BMW of North America (BMW) is recalling certain 2023-2024 X1, 2024-2025 X5, 2025 X6, 2023-2025 X7, 740i, 760i, 2024 XM, 530i, 540i, i7, 750e, X2, 2024-2025 i5, 2024 Rolls Royce Spectre, 2025 MINI Countryman S ALL4, JCW Countryman ALL4, and 2025 MINI Hardtop 2 Door (Cooper, Cooper S) vehicles. Please refer to the recall report for the complete list of models. The welds in the servomotor of the integrated brake control module may break, causing a loss of power brake assist and rear brake function. In addition, the Antilock Brake System (ABS) and Dynamic Stability Control (DSC) system may not function.
- Consequence: A loss of brake power assist or rear brake function can result in extended stopping distance. A loss of ABS or DSC can cause a loss of vehicle handling and control. Either of these scenarios can increase the risk of a crash.
- Remedy: Dealers will replace the integrated brake system,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ed November 8, 2024. Owners can contact BMW Customer Service at 1-800-525-7417.

Vehicle year: 2013
Hi there! I recently purchased a 2013 BMW X5 5.0i xDrive with the N64 Engine. Unfortunately, I've had a couple of issues with it. Specifically, I've noticed excessive exhaust smoke due to oil leaking through the valve guides, as well as oil leaks from the upper oil pan. These problems started at 48,000 miles and I now have 53,000 miles. When I reached out to BMW Service, they informed me that they couldn't repair the problems because the vehicle was out of warranty. The BMW Dealer Service quoted me $8,000 for the value guide repair and $3,200 for the upper oil pan repair, which seems like a lot for a low mileage vehicle. I believe that vehicles with this low of mileage should not be leaking or burning oil for any reason, and I think this is a design flaw in BMW's engineering that they should address.
